What You’ll Do - Design, build, and ship production features across Vallor’s TypeScript stack - Own backend services, APIs, integrations, data flows, and serverless infrastructure - Contribute to the frontend when needed using Next.js and TypeScript - Work directly with enterprise customers to understand their workflows and technical requirements - Translate customer needs into well-scoped, maintainable product features - Communicate tradeoffs, clarify requirements, and push back constructively when needed - Build integrations across enterprise systems, contract platforms, communication tools, and third-party APIs - Design and maintain serverless, event-driven systems on AWS - Contribute to infrastructure-as-code workflows using SST and related tooling - Use AI coding agents extensively to accelerate development and parallelize work - Review, test, debug, and improve AI-generated code rather than accepting raw output - Maintain a high standard for code quality, security, reliability, and maintainability - Help shape engineering practices and technical direction as the team grows - Identify opportunities beyond the initial customer requirements and turn them into valuable product improvements Qualifications - Senior or Staff-level software engineering experience - Deep professional experience with TypeScript - Strong backend engineering skills using Node.js, Bun, or similar runtimes - Ability to contribute across the full stack, including modern React or Next.js applications - Experience building and operating production systems on AWS - Strong understanding of serverless and event-driven architecture - Experience designing APIs, integrations, and distributed backend workflows - Experience with PostgreSQL or similar relational databases - Familiarity with infrastructure as code - Strong product judgment and ability to turn ambiguous needs into shipped solutions - Excellent written and verbal English communication - Ability to work directly with customers and non-technical stakeholders - Strong organization, attention to detail, and project ownership - Experience using advanced AI coding tools or agents as a core part of daily development - Ability to critically review and take ownership of AI-generated code Requirements - Previous experience as a founding engineer or early-stage startup engineer - Experience in a forward-deployed, solutions engineering, implementation, or technical consulting role - Experience working directly with enterprise customers - Deep knowledge of AWS infrastructure and systems architecture - Experience with SST, Pulumi, or comparable infrastructure-as-code tools - Experience coordinating multiple AI coding agents in parallel - Experience building enterprise AI products or workflow-automation platforms - Experience integrating with systems such as SAP, NetSuite, Salesforce, Snowflake, Microsoft 365, Slack, or contract lifecycle management platforms - Public projects, open-source contributions, or code samples that demonstrate engineering quality - Experience bringing structure and engineering maturity to a small, fast-growing team Benefits - Target range of USD $100,000–$140,000 annually, with flexibility up to approximately $200,000 for exceptional talent - Remote work options, with a preference for candidates in Europe Company Description Our client is building an enterprise-ready AI coworker for procurement, legal, and sales teams. Its platform connects with the systems companies already use—including ERPs, contract platforms, email, and collaboration tools—to review contracts, surface risks, track obligations, and deliver grounded answers with citations to the underlying source data. Rather than requiring customers to replace their existing workflows, Vallor integrates directly with their technology stack and helps teams automate contract review, negotiation, renewals, compliance, and value recovery. Our client is an early-stage company with an 11-person team and a highly AI-native engineering culture. As the company expands its enterprise customer base, it is looking for a senior engineer who can combine excellent product engineering with ownership, customer empathy, and strong technical judgment.

Role Description Our client is building next-generation financial infrastructure that enables real-time movement of digital money across traditional banking systems and digital asset networks. They are looking for a technically strong Client Support Engineer to serve as the primary support contact for partner financial institutions, helping diagnose, troubleshoot, and resolve operational and technical issues across their payments platform. This role sits at the intersection of technical support, operations, and engineering, making it ideal for candidates who enjoy solving complex problems, working directly with customers, and improving support processes in fast-paced environments. What You'll Do - Serve as the Primary Technical Contact for Financial Institution Partners - Act as the first point of contact for partner banks and financial institutions experiencing technical or operational issues. - Investigate and resolve support requests related to API behavior, connectivity, payment processing, and operational workflows. - Commun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ders throughout the resolution process. - Manage and Resolve Operational Exceptions - Monitor support queues and exception management systems. - Triage, investigate, and drive incidents to resolution. - Escalate complex issues to Engineering when necessary and coordinate follow-through until closure. - Conduct root cause analysis and document findings. - Improve Support Operations - Create and maintain support documentation, runbooks, troubleshooting guides, and escalation procedures. - Identify recurring issues and work with Engineering and Product teams to improve reliability and reduce support volume. - Contribute to the design and scaling of support processes, monitoring practices, and operational workflows. - Collaborate Cross-Functionally - Partner closely with Engineering, Product, and Operations teams. - Provide actionable feedback based on customer and operational trends. - Help shape a scalable support function within a growing fintech environment. Qualifications - 3+ years of experience in a client-facing Support Engineering, Technical Support Engineering, Solutions Engineering, or Production Support role. - Experience supporting customers in fintech, payments, banking, financial infrastructure, or related industries. - Strong troubleshooting and root cause analysis skills. - Experience working directly with APIs, including testing and debugging REST APIs using tools such as Postman. - Familiarity with monitoring and observability platforms such as Grafana, Datadog, Splunk, or similar. - Working knowledge of Linux command line and networking fundamentals. - Excellent written and verbal communication skills. - Ability to manage multiple support cases independently and drive issues to resolution. Nice-to-Have Qualifications - Experience supporting banks, payment processors, or financial institutions. - Knowledge of payment systems, money movement, banking infrastructure, or financial operations. - Experience with blockchain technology, digital assets, stablecoins, tokenized deposits, or cryptocurrency platforms. - Familiarity with automation and configuration management tools such as Ansible, Chef, or Terraform. - Experience working in startup or high-growth environments. What Success Looks Like - Support tickets are resolved accurately and efficiently. - Partner institutions receive timely and professional technical support. - Operational incidents are investigated thoroughly and documented clearly. - Support processes become increasingly scalable through automation, documentation, and continuous improvement. - Strong collaboration exists between Support, Engineering, and Product teams to improve platform reliability and customer experience. Benefits - Competitive salary - USD 88-100K (up to 110k for NY/SF area). - Equity participation. -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ision coverage. - 401(k) with employer matching. - Flexible PTO. - Fully remote work environment. Location Requirement - Candidates must be based in the United States and willing to travel occasionally as needed.
